The second book in the Sinful Brides Series is definitely a keeper.   Ryker and Penny are two completely opposites that wind up together in a incredible story of danger, redemption, forgiveness and most of all Love.

Ryker grew up on the streets in St. GIles and has no use for anyone or anything that will take him away from his gaming hell and his adopted brothers.  He is ruthless and believes this is the only way to live.  Don't let anyone into his world that will jeopardize his club.  He especially has no use for the nobility, having been born the bastard son of a Duke, and then sold to a ruthless criminal hours after he was born.  Unfortunately his younger sister is married to a nobleman and she has talked him into attending a ball at her home.  Scandal erupts when he drags a young lady out from under a bench in the garden where he escaped from the Ballroom.  He is discovered by the young ladies brother while he is holding her down and looking for a weapon.  Ryker thinks that she is in league with his competition and enemy.

Penny Tidemore is determined to prove to her family that she will be the exception to the numerous scandals that have plagued her family over the years.  Penny is a dreamer who only sees the good in people and she will have her happily ever after with her Prince Charming.  As to mock her and her efforts to find love she winds up a participant in a major scandal with a gambling hell owner.  They are forced to marry to save her reputation and his club.  

From the start Ryker has avoided her and shuts her out of his life.  She cannot compete with the most important thing in his life, his club.  Ryker does not know how to treat a wife, especially a noble one.  He restricts her their room,  never to enter the gaming floor and bother him while he is working.  Penny has no 
intention of being locked away from the world.  She will push and test Ryker's patience to see that she is not going to blindly follow his dictates.  Penny is convinced that she can bring Ryker out of the darkness that has been his life, and into the light of day with love and determination.

Christi writes a beautiful, heart wrenching story that will make you smile as Penny pushes all of husband's buttons.  Her writing is poignant, strong and you can actually feel the emotions that Ryker and Penny feel while reading.  You can read the strength that she instills in Ryker and Penny.  Christi's books are a pure joy to read.  Christi is an amazing writer and she should be at the top of your must read list!

The Sinful Bride series is a raw and emotional journey into the underbelly of Regency England. As we step into this dangerous land of the forgotten, abused and discarded, we begin to see men and women of incomparable strength ,who blazed their own path in life despite the cruelties of their conditions. 

The Tidemore family is a true oddity in the Ton world. They are a family who love each other above are else. A family who allowes cheer and happiness invade all areas of their life, despite the Ton's unspoken rule on what makes a proper family. The Tidemore's refusal to bend to the will of the Society have forced this family to live within its fringes. 

Penelope Tidemore always dreamed of living a grand adventure away from the strict rules of Society. Her older siblings refusal play the Ton's games, has left the reputation of the Tidemore's in tatters. Penelope believes it is her responsibility to repair her family's reputation by being all things proper. She stifles all her dreams and desires in order to be accepted by the Ton. However, the Ton is a cruel and unforgiven place and instead of welcoming Penelope with open arms, she is welcomed with rumors and vicious whispers. 

Penelope's hopes for the Season are ruined when she is found in the arms of a notorious gaming hell owner, Ryker Black. Ryker is the illegitimate son a Duke, who grew up on the streets of St. Giles doing anything to survive. This latest scandal leaves little option for these two and they are forced to wed in order to save what they love most. 

Ryker has lead a well ordered life. He has suffered horrors no child should endure. He crawled and scratched his way from the gutter to the top. His marriage to Penelope throws his carefully constructed world into chaos. 

Ryker soon learns that Penelope is not some spoiled pampered miss, but is a women who has suffered her own loss and pain. As the two spend more time together, Ryker begins to let Penelope in. The more Ryker gives in the harder he pushes back and Penelope struggles to find her footing in this new world. 

I loved finally getting to know Ryker and his brothers. These are strong yet vulnerable man. They have been forced to grow up at a far to young age, but still harbor the shame and guilt of their choices behind gruff exterior. Ryker was so scared to let anyone in, that when Penelope finally broke through it was amazing to see. 

Penelope also went through so much growth in this book. She had buried who she was under the weight of Society's expectation that once she was out of that world, she truly started to develop into the strong Tidemore women we new she was. I love how she took responsibility for her actions and dealt with the consequences head on and refused to let her family intervene. 

Ms. Caldwell has crafted yet another amazing story in this series. As she opens the door to the other side of England, we begin to fall in love with the people who learn to blaze their own path in life and refuse to bow to the demands society places on them.

I can't believe I doubted Christi Caldwell's ability to make the cold, unfeeling Ryker Black into a romantic hero.  For I truly did - I looked back at my review of the previous book, and this is what I said: "I am a bit wary of reading a book with Helena's brother as the hero. I guess we will see when the time comes how much redemption can be done."  I  am sorry, Christi, and I am also brilliantly happy that I was wrong!

Ryker Black is hardened from a life of blood, crime, and no love.  Surrounding himself with his brothers but refusing to let anyone beyond the walls of his heart, he lives day by day for his security and that of his gaming hell.  But he didn't plan on Lady Penelope Tidesmore, and when she comes blazing into his life after a mishap at a ball, those walls which have kept him controlled for so long gradually begin to crumble.  Penelope had her heart set on respectability, but one mistake at a ball leaves her with no choice but to marry a scoundrel like Ryker.  It doesn't take her long to see the possibilities, though, and she sees Ryker and his makeshift family as a challenge she is determined to meet.  

It is fitting that this book is released on Valentine's Day, because it truly is a masterpiece of romantic literature.  There is such depth in both characters that one minute you think you know all there is to know about them, and the next you are blown away by that extra layer you never knew was there.  Given that Ryker had been introduced as an unfeeling jerk in the previous book, I was pleasantly surprised to find that he really is just very guarded.  Never knowing love, he can't even recognize it anymore, and emotions are only a display of weakness.  That is why it was so beautiful to see the way Penelope allowed his true character to blossom, and I fell in love with him right alongside Penelope.  She was a gem herself, never allowing the cruelty of others to make her become cruel herself.  Ultimately, in the end, her kindness and selflessness showed in an amazing way.  If only we all could be a little more like Penelope.

The ending is fantastic, so if you're on the fence about finishing the book, you need to rethink that.  It was magical, truly one of the most romantic scenes I have read in a long time.  Christi Caldwell has proven to be incapable of producing a bad book.  I have yet to read one book of hers I did not like.  All I can say is, if you haven't read her books yet, you are missing out.
